Wind Conducting Symposium 2019
« Back Tuesday, July 02, 2019 to Friday, July 05, 2019
With Dr. Wendy McCallum from Brandon University and UofT's Gillian MacKay and Jeffrey Reynolds
This is a four-day intensive session designed for teachers and conductors at all levels.
We will explore the Art of Conducting and the Art of Teaching, working to help everyone improve their skills and understanding in a positive learning environment.
Topics of Discussion
- Repertoire
- Score Study
- Rehearsal Technique
- Leadership
- Classroom Problem Solving
- Movement and Gesture
- Band Pedagogy
Daily Schedule
Mornings: lectures, presentations, discussions
Afternoons: live conducting with ensemble consisting of UofT ensemble members and participants
